Output ec5c649b205f1a324f4a54894396c68a155f2b75c9351c2cd972b51f5bd39622:0

value
1096563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c9cf5869c8006d6c99d5dcbdf76b1f3a305a74 OP_EQUAL
address
3AhMuLtkCsroLVVheBZFsck48zqWyDyFJj
transaction
ec5c649b205f1a324f4a54894396c68a155f2b75c9351c2cd972b51f5bd39622
spent
true